10 years on from the launch of the Attainment Challenge, the attainment gap between young people from the most and least deprived areas meeting standards in literacy has reached a record low.
Under this SNP government, the poverty-related gap for young people leaving school and going on to a positive destination has reduced by 60 per cent since 2009 - narrowing at all three key qualification levels.
